School Custodian

A school custodian is responsible for maintaining a clean, safe, and functional environment within educational facilities, performing various cleaning and maintenance tasks to support the school community. Key responsibilities include: Cleaning and Maintenance: Perform routine cleaning tasks such as sweeping, mopping, vacuuming, dusting, and sanitizing classrooms, hallways, restrooms, and common areas. Waste Management: Collect and dispose of waste and recyclables in accordance with school policies, ensuring proper separation of materials. Minor Repairs: Conduct minor repairs and maintenance tasks, such as changing light bulbs, fixing leaky faucets, and unclogging drains. Safety Checks: Regularly inspect facilities for potential safety hazards and report any issues to maintenance or school administration. Event Setup: Assist in the setup and teardown of school events, including arranging furniture and equipment as needed. Inventory Management: Monitor and maintain inventory of cleaning supplies and equipment, requesting purchases when necessary. Qualifications: Education: A high school diploma or equivalent is typically required. Courses in maintenance, basic repair, and safety can be beneficial. Experience: Prior experience in custodial or janitorial services is a plus, but many custodians start with minimal experience and receive on-the-job training. Skills: Attention to detail, time management, communication skills, physical stamina, and problem-solving abilities are essential for success in this role. Working Conditions: Custodians may work early morning or late evening shifts, depending on the school's schedule. The role can be physically demanding, requiring lifting, bending, and standing for extended periods.
